Как поменять старый домен на новый через SQL: простое руководство для начинающих

Чтобы поменять старый домен на новый через SQL, вам нужно обновить все записи, которые содержат старый домен, и заменить его на новый домен. Для этого используйте оператор UPDATE. Вот пример:

UPDATE вашаТаблица
SET полеДомена = REPLACE(полеДомена, 'старыйдомен', 'новыйдомен')

Замените «вашаТаблица» на имя вашей таблицы, «полеДомена» на имя столбца, содержащего домен, 'старыйдомен' на ваш старый домен и 'новыйдомен' на ваш новый домен.

Не забудьте выполнить резервное копирование базы данных перед выполнением такого обновления, чтобы иметь возможность восстановиться, если что-то пойдет не так.

Детальный ответ

Прежде чем я расскажу вам, как поменять старый домен на новый через SQL, необходимо понимать, что SQL - это язык для работы с базами данных. Он позволяет нам манипулировать данными внутри базы данных, в том числе и изменять информацию о домене.

Для того чтобы поменять домен, нужно выполнить следующие шаги:

  1. Обновить таблицу, которая содержит информацию о домене
  2. Изменить все записи в таблицах, где домен использовался
  3. Обновить все ссылки на старый домен на новый в соответствующих таблицах

Давайте рассмотрим каждый шаг подробнее.

Шаг 1: Обновление таблицы домена

Для начала мы должны обновить таблицу, в которой хранится информация о домене. Предположим, что у нас есть таблица с названием "domains", которая содержит поле "domain_name", где хранится имя текущего домена.

UPDATE domains SET domain_name = 'новый_домен.ru' WHERE id = 1;

В этом примере мы обновляем значение поля "domain_name" на "новый_домен.ru" для записи с идентификатором 1. Пожалуйста, убедитесь, что замените "новый_домен.ru" на фактическое новое имя вашего домена и "id" на реальный идентификатор записи.

Шаг 2: Изменение записей в других таблицах

Если в других таблицах используется старый домен, вы должны обновить соответствующие записи. Для этого вам нужно определить, в каких таблицах и полях используется домен, и затем выполнить соответствующие обновления.

UPDATE other_table SET url = REPLACE(url, 'старый_домен.ru', 'новый_домен.ru'); 

В этом примере мы обновляем все записи в таблице "other_table", заменяя все вхождения старого домена "старый_домен.ru" на новый домен "новый_домен.ru" в поле "url". Замените "other_table" на имя вашей таблицы и "url" на имя вашего поля, где используется домен.

Шаг 3: Обновление ссылок на новый домен

Наконец, нужно обновить все ссылки на старый домен на новый в соответствующих таблицах. Для этого можно использовать функцию REPLACE() в SQL.

UPDATE some_table SET content = REPLACE(content, 'старый_домен.ru', 'новый_домен.ru'); 

В этом примере мы обновляем все записи в таблице "some_table", заменяя все вхождения старого домена "старый_домен.ru" на новый домен "новый_домен.ru" в поле "content". Замените "some_table" на имя вашей таблицы и "content" на имя вашего поля, содержащего ссылки на домен.

Теперь у вас должна быть представление о том, как можно поменять старый домен на новый через SQL. Помните, что эти примеры лишь общая иллюстрация. Точные запросы и их условия могут различаться в зависимости от ваших особых требований и схемы базы данных.

Видео по теме

Как переехать на новый домен без проблем?

Переносим домен самостоятельно

2.7 Изменение порта SQL Server и добавление правила в брандмауэр Windows

Похожие статьи:

Как присоединить базу данных SQL bak

Как правильно писать базу данных SQL: полезные советы и фишки

Как посмотреть лицензию SQL: подробная инструкция для начинающих

Как поменять старый домен на новый через SQL: простое руководство для начинающих

Как писать SQL запросы к БД: руководство для начинающих

Как перенести tempdb на другой диск в SQL 2008: подробная инструкция